Description
Monocrystalline silicon wafers are also widely used in the semiconductor industry to manufacture electronic components, such as integrated circuits, transistors, and diodes.
To produce monocrystalline silicon wafers for semiconductors, a similar process is used as for solar cells. The silicon is purified using the Czochralski process, and a single crystal is grown from a seed crystal in a high-temperature environment. However, the resulting wafers are much thinner, typically between 100 and 200 micrometers thick.
